Loudspeaker cone with raised curved protrusions and methods for controlling resonant modes

1. A diaphragm having an inner opening, a central region proximate the inner opening, and an outer peripheral edge, the diaphragm comprising:
a front skin having a front surface; a back skin have a rear surface; a foam core encapsulated within the front skin and the back skin; and
a plurality of radially arrayed, distally projecting protrusions defined as convex surfaces or channel-like protrusions extending in spaced curvilinear arcs from the central region to a proximity of the outer peripheral edge;
wherein the substantially uniform cross-sectional thickness is 0.5 mm.
